Newton Community Service Center began as the West Newton Day Nursery in 1907, and while the program has evolved substantially to meet modern day family needs, our tradition of individual attention has never wavered.
 
The center-based Child Care Program
works closely with parents to understand each child's needs and abilities. Our teachers and staff are caring and dedicated. We provide early care and education for all children - with learning opportunities geared to the ages and abilities of those in the group. We also have the unique advantage of a gymnasium, as well as a beautiful, newly renovated playground on site.
 
Infant/Toddler Center
Our caring, experienced staff promotes an atmosphere in which each child's individuality is recognized and encouraged, offering full-time care for children between 3 months and 2 years/ 9 months, in a cheerful, sunny environment.
 
Preschool
Learning and creative activities are incorporated into free as well as structured periods during the day. Children learn to become participating members of a group as they develop a strong sense of their preschool community. Special projects and presentations help children move toward self-initiated discoveries.
